构建Angular应用程序有多种方法,下面是一种常见的解决方法:首先,确保你已经安装了Node.js和npm(Node.js的包管理器)。在终端或命令提示符中,...
使用Angular路由器中的Location服务来重写URL。以下是示例代码:import { Component } from '@angular/core'...
当Angular应用程序检测到数组被视为对象并返回错误时,可以尝试以下解决方法:确保正确使用数组:确保在应用程序中使用数组时,使用正确的语法和方法。例如,使用[...
要在VSTS中进行Angular应用程序的持续集成,可以按照以下步骤进行:创建VSTS项目:在VSTS中创建一个新的项目,或者使用现有的项目。设置版本控制:将A...
在Angular中,通过HostListener监听window的“beforeunload”事件,可以检查页面是否将被卸载或关闭。但是,如果您使用了RxJS的...
在Angular应用程序的生产环境中,CORS-anywhere可能不起作用,因为它是一个代理服务器,用于解决跨域资源共享(CORS)问题。在生产环境中,可能需...
要将Angular应用程序编译为生产代码,可以按照以下步骤进行操作:首先,确保已经安装了Node.js和Angular CLI。如果尚未安装,请前往官方网站下载...
要确保Angular应用程序仅在特定的Chrome语言设置下工作,可以使用Angular的国际化(i18n)功能来实现。下面是一个解决方法,包含一些代码示例:首...
Angular可以使用WebSocket和服务器端推送技术来实现实时的数据更新和通知。这可以通过socket.io来实现。首先在Angular应用程序中,创建一...
Angular应用程序的首次加载时间问题主要是由于应用程序的体积过大,导致浏览器需要下载和解析大量的代码和资源文件,从而导致加载时间较长。以下是一些解决方法和代...
在后端服务器上配置 CORS 策略以允许跨域请求。可以使用 Express 框架来在服务器中启用 CORS,例如:const express = require...
当Angular应用程序经过成功编译后呈现空白页面时,可能是由于以下几个原因导致的:错误的路由配置:检查应用程序的路由配置是否正确,确保路由指向正确的组件。组件...
这个问题可能是由于以下几个原因导致的:身份验证问题、API 路由问题或者 Function App 配置问题。下面是一些可能的解决方法:确保 Angular 应...
在Angular中,默认情况下,URL中会显示一个“#”符号,这是由于Angular使用了HashLocationStrategy来处理路由。但是,你可以使用P...
要判断Angular应用程序中的SharedWorker是否已经存在,可以使用以下方法:创建一个SharedWorkerService,用于管理SharedWo...
在 app.module.ts 中导入 TranslateModule,并使用 forRoot() 方法加载翻译文件:import { NgModule } f...
在Angular应用程序中,通常只能有一个根模块。然而,有时候我们希望在同一个应用程序中使用多个根模块来实现不同的功能或加载不同的模块。为了在Angular应用...
问题描述:在Angular应用程序中,可能会遇到类声明存在问题的情况,这可能是由于装饰器使用不正确造成的。解决方法:确保装饰器的使用方式正确。在Angular中...
在Angular应用程序中,可以使用本地存储(localStorage)来存储和获取值。以下是一个在应用程序引导时从本地存储加载值的示例代码:在app.modu...
在Angular应用中,实时服务器可以返回各种类型的响应,包括文本、JSON、二进制数据等。具体返回什么类型的响应取决于服务器端的实现和应用的需求。以下是一个使...